Ilamentia is a first-person actiony puzzler, featuring 96 challenging mind-bender levels. Some rooms focus on brain-melting logic, others rely on sharp reactions, but many more will test the limits of every facet of your cognitive faculties.

Ilamentia is kind of like a 3D/first-person version of Case's other game, Straima. In both games you have to "kill" objects in a map (blobs/soul) and neither bothers explaining this to you. Both games have a distinct style, but while the weirdness works in 2D it doesn't in 3D. It just looks like a crappy version of heaven from a 90s B-movie.

I played it for a bit and i just don't care for it. The environment makes the worse, as does the style. If you give people an objective (kill X), don't make it too vague to determine if X is actually dead. There's also too much trial and error and nonsense like a puzzle where the solution isn't in the level. The "hints" button is fairly useless too.

A few people will love this game, the remaining 95+% will get stuck after 10 minutes, shrug and movie on to something less aggressively player-unfriendly.
